    Intuitive Machines (LUNR) Stock Surges 14% on $180M NASA Lunar Contract

    Key Highlights

    • Intuitive Machines secured a $180.4 million NASA contract for transporting seven payloads to the Moon’s South Pole area
    • Cargo includes an Australian Space Agency rover and components from Blue Origin’s Honeybee Robotics division
    • This marks the company’s fifth assignment through NASA’s Commercial Lunar Payload Services initiative
    • Cantor Fitzgerald’s Andres Sheppard maintained a Buy rating with a $26 target price
    • Approximately 90% of Wall Street analysts rate LUNR as a Buy, compared to 55–60% for typical S&P 500 companies

    Shares of Intuitive Machines rallied nearly 14% during Wednesday’s trading session following NASA‘s announcement of a $180.4 million contract award. The space exploration company will transport seven scientific and technological payloads to the lunar South Pole region. The gains were particularly significant given the stock’s 12% decline just one day earlier.

    The previous day’s selloff occurred when NASA revealed plans to temporarily halt its Gateway program—a proposed space station intended to orbit the Moon. This news initially rattled investors. However, Wednesday’s substantial contract announcement demonstrated that opportunities in the lunar commercial sector remain robust.

    This latest award operates under NASA’s Commercial Lunar Payload Services initiative, commonly referred to as CLPS. Rather than developing proprietary spacecraft, NASA has adopted a strategy of contracting private companies for lunar transportation services. This represents Intuitive Machines’ fifth CLPS assignment—demonstrating an expanding operational history.

    The mission scope is substantial. Cargo includes a lunar rover from the Australian Space Agency along with advanced technology developed by Blue Origin’s Honeybee Robotics subsidiary. The mission will require a large-scale, cargo-capable lander equipped for autonomous operations on the lunar surface.

    Andres Sheppard, an analyst at Cantor Fitzgerald, characterized the contract win as “bullish” in his Wednesday research note. He reaffirmed his Buy recommendation and maintained his $26 price objective for the shares.

    Wall Street Remains Optimistic

    Sheppard expressed confidence in additional upside potential. He positioned himself as a buyer during price weakness and outlined several forthcoming catalysts that could drive the stock higher.

    These potential catalysts include the anticipated SiriusXM 11 satellite delivery scheduled for the first half of 2026, subsequent CLPS payload assignments, a pending Lunar Terrain Vehicle contract determination, and possible contracts related to the Golden Dome missile defense initiative.

    Roughly 90% of analysts tracking LUNR stock maintain Buy ratings, based on FactSet data. This significantly exceeds the standard 55–60% Buy-rating proportion observed across S&P 500 constituents. The consensus analyst price target hovers around $24.

    Strategic Implications for LUNR

    NASA’s Gateway program pause actually redirects focus toward lunar surface capabilities and infrastructure—precisely the operational domain of Intuitive Machines. The CLPS program continues to move forward without interruption.

    The company currently holds a market capitalization near $3.89 billion, with year-to-date share price appreciation of approximately 10% prior to this week’s movement.

    Daily trading volume typically exceeds 11 million shares, indicating Wednesday’s price surge was backed by substantial market participation.

    Both the S&P 500 and Dow Jones Industrial Average posted gains of approximately 0.6% during the session, meaning Intuitive Machines significantly outperformed major market indices.

    Technical indicators currently show a Buy signal for the stock. With the new contract secured and multiple growth catalysts identified, analyst community remains committed to their bullish projections.

    Cantor Fitzgerald’s $26 price objective implies approximately 27% potential upside from Wednesday’s closing price of $20.41.
